Delving into Secondary School EFL Teachers’ Practices Facilitated by Task-Based Language Instruction
The implementation of Task-Based Instruction (TBI) has resulted in a productive transformation for many foreign language teachers, since it emphasizes the importance of context and meaningful language use.
